hi guys . today i opened qt.nokia.com . i saw qt site and i must pay for download qt library !! i think Qt have 2 license , open source and commercial . what's happening ?
-
Although Digia has acquired Qt from Nokia, nothing has changed regarding licensing. There are still commercial and open sources licenses available as before.
Keep in mind that Digia has been handling the commercial licensing up until now as their primary focus, so there are still changes that are being made to their web site to accommodate the merging of the Nokia stuff. There's still a "please bear with us" message on the top of the page, also. So, I'm sure that over the next short period of time the web site will begin to reflect more of the options available.

then i must go qt-project.org instead of qt.nokia.com ?
-
You can still get the open source downloads through qt-project.org, yes.
-
qt.nokia.com was the corporate site for Qt that Nokia created, all documentation and community content was moved to qt-project.org. The only difference now is that qt.digia.com is now the corporate site.
